Melanoma cell lines show higher levels of OXPHOS compared to HDFs. ( a ) The left and right panels represent two separate western blots because of the equal size of the MTCO2 (CIV) and the NDUFS4 (CI) protein. ( b – g ) Western blot analysis for subunits of OXPHOS complexes (CI-CV), VDAC1 and vinculin in HDF1, WM3311, A375, WM47 and WM3000 cells. ( h – m ) Absolute activities of citrate synthase and OXPHOS complexes in HDF1, WM3311, A375, WM47 and WM3000 cells. Values are given as mean ± SD. One-way ANOVA followed by Dunnett’s Multiple Comparison Test; * p ≤ 0.05; ** p ≤ 0.01; *** p ≤ 0.001; **** p ≤ 0.0001. For western blot and enzymatic activity: post-nuclear supernatant containing the mitochondrial fraction was used. Two and three independent experiments were performed for western blot (n = 2) and enzymatic activity (n = 3), respectively. The levels of OXPHOS complexes and VDAC1 were normalized to vinculin. The activities of the OXPHOS complexes were normalized to protein concentration in cell lysates. Citrate synthase (CS); Complex I (CI); Complex II (CII); Complex III (CIII); Complex IV (CIV); Complex V (CV).

Journal: Biomolecules

Article Title: Targeting Mitochondria in Melanoma

doi: 10.3390/biom10101395

Figure Lengend Snippet: Melanoma cell lines show higher levels of OXPHOS compared to HDFs. ( a ) The left and right panels represent two separate western blots because of the equal size of the MTCO2 (CIV) and the NDUFS4 (CI) protein. ( b – g ) Western blot analysis for subunits of OXPHOS complexes (CI-CV), VDAC1 and vinculin in HDF1, WM3311, A375, WM47 and WM3000 cells. ( h – m ) Absolute activities of citrate synthase and OXPHOS complexes in HDF1, WM3311, A375, WM47 and WM3000 cells. Values are given as mean ± SD. One-way ANOVA followed by Dunnett’s Multiple Comparison Test; * p ≤ 0.05; ** p ≤ 0.01; *** p ≤ 0.001; **** p ≤ 0.0001. For western blot and enzymatic activity: post-nuclear supernatant containing the mitochondrial fraction was used. Two and three independent experiments were performed for western blot (n = 2) and enzymatic activity (n = 3), respectively. The levels of OXPHOS complexes and VDAC1 were normalized to vinculin. The activities of the OXPHOS complexes were normalized to protein concentration in cell lysates. Citrate synthase (CS); Complex I (CI); Complex II (CII); Complex III (CIII); Complex IV (CIV); Complex V (CV).

Article Snippet: The melanoma cell lines WM3311 (BRAF/NRAS wild-type; Wistar Institute, Philadelphia, PA, USA), WM3000 (BRAFwt/NRASQ61R; Rockland Inc., Philadelphia, PA, USA), WM47 (BRAFV600E/NRASwt; Wistar Institute, Philadelphia, PA, USA) were cultured in MCDB153 Medium (Sigma Aldrich, Darmstadt, Germany) supplemented with 20% Leibovitz’s L-15 Medium (Sigma Aldrich, Darmstadt, Germany), 10% fetal bovine serum (FBS) (Gibco, Darmstadt, Germany), 1% Penicillin-Streptomycin-Amphotericin mixture (Lonza, Basel, Switzerland), 1.68 mM CaCl 2 (Sigma Aldrich, Darmstadt, Germany) and 5 μg/mL insulin (Sigma Aldrich, Darmstadt, Germany).

Cellular WM853 and MDA-MB-435S clone characteristics. ( a ) SIRT2 expression in SCW3 and SSW30 clones of WM853 cells and SCM1 and SSM15 clones of MDA-MB-435S as evidenced by Western blotting. ( b ) The cytotoxic effects of dasatinib treatment (48 h) on melanoma SCW3 and SSW30 clones of the WM853 cell line, as evidenced using the neutral red assay, mean ± SD, ( n = 3, independent experiments) ( c ) The cytotoxic effects of dasatinib treatment (48 h) on melanoma SCM1 and SSM15 clones of the MDA-MB-435S cell line, as evidenced using the neutral red assay, mean ± SD, ( n = 3, independent experiments).

Journal: Cancers

Article Title: SIRT2 Contributes to the Resistance of Melanoma Cells to the Multikinase Inhibitor Dasatinib

doi: 10.3390/cancers11050673

Figure Lengend Snippet: Cellular WM853 and MDA-MB-435S clone characteristics. ( a ) SIRT2 expression in SCW3 and SSW30 clones of WM853 cells and SCM1 and SSM15 clones of MDA-MB-435S as evidenced by Western blotting. ( b ) The cytotoxic effects of dasatinib treatment (48 h) on melanoma SCW3 and SSW30 clones of the WM853 cell line, as evidenced using the neutral red assay, mean ± SD, ( n = 3, independent experiments) ( c ) The cytotoxic effects of dasatinib treatment (48 h) on melanoma SCM1 and SSM15 clones of the MDA-MB-435S cell line, as evidenced using the neutral red assay, mean ± SD, ( n = 3, independent experiments).

Article Snippet: The human melanoma cell line WM853 (stage: primary/vertical growth) was purchased from Rockland (Rockland, Limerick, PA, USA) and was maintained in Tumor Specialized Medium containing 80% MCDB153 (Sigma-Aldrich, St. Louis, MO, USA), 20% Leibovitz’s (Sigma-Aldrich, St. Louis, MO, USA), 2% fetal bovine serum (Pan Biotech GmbH, Aidenbach, Germany), 1.68 mM calcium chloride, and 1.2 g (11.2 mM) sodium bicarbonate at 37 °C in a humidified atmosphere containing 5% CO 2 .

Techniques: Expressing, Clone Assay, Western Blot, Neutral Red Assay
